Types of Welding Certifications

Although the AWS’ standard CW (Certified Welder) card paves the way for most jobs, specific industries will require their own specialized certification. Examples of the most-widely used of which appear below.

  • CWI and SCWI Certificates for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
  • American Petroleum Institute Certification for individuals who deal with pipelines in the energy field
  • Certified Welder Certificates to become a Certified Welder
  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for individuals that focus on boiler and pressurized vessels

What You Need to Know in Welding Programs

You have made a decision that you might want to be a welding specialist, and soon you’ll have to determine which of the certified welding schools is right. The first task in starting a position as a welding specialist is to pick which of the leading welder schools will be right for you. Before you sign a contract with the welding specialist school you have selected, it’s strongly encouraged that you confirm the certification status of the training course with the AWS. Although they are not as necessary as the program’s accreditation status, you might like to look at the following parts too:

  • Be sure the college’s program offers training in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
  • Search for courses that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
  • Determine if the college offers financial support
  • Make certain the school teaches on tools that fits up-to-date industry standards
